  • Publication number: 20190246612
    Abstract: A fishing lure comprising: i) a body segment; ii) a tail segment; iii) a linkage for coupling the body segment and the tail segment; iv) a first magnet coupled to the body segment; and v) a second magnet coupled to the tail segment. The first and second magnets are set up in a state of repulsion in order to move the body segment and tail segment apart. The linkage is adjustable in length in order to increase or decrease the force of repulsion between the first and second magnets.

  • Publication number: 20190196503
    Abstract: In one embodiment, a method includes a computing system receiving information from an autonomous vehicle (AV). Based on the received information, the system may identify a target objective, with an associated target destination, for the AV and determine that the AV is able to transport passengers while furthering the target objective. The system may receive multiple ride requests from ride requestors, respectively. Each of the ride requests is associated with an origination location and a destination location. The system may match the AV with one of the ride requests based on a location of the AV, the target destination of the target objective, and the origination location and destination location associated with the ride request. The system may instruct the AV to perform a transportation task from the origination location to the destination location associated with the ride request, and drive to the target destination after completing the transportation task.

  • Publication number: 20190197497
    Abstract: In particular embodiments, a computing system may receive an indication of an impaired sensor component from a first autonomous vehicle. The system may identify a sensor type of the impaired sensor component and determine a suitable service center for servicing the sensor type based on one or more criteria. The system may identify a second autonomous vehicle. The second autonomous vehicle has a functional sensor component of the sensor type. The system may send instructions to the second autonomous vehicle to drive to a location of the first autonomous vehicle and share sensor data from the functional sensor component with the first autonomous vehicle. The first autonomous vehicle may be instructed to drive to the service center location using sensor data of the second autonomous vehicle. The second autonomous vehicle may be instructed to drive to the service center location with the first autonomous vehicle.

  • Publication number: 20190197798
    Abstract: In particular embodiments, a computing system may generate a prediction of requests for autonomous vehicles in a fleet of collectively managed autonomous vehicles based on a current condition and a future event, the prediction including a predicted request level and a predicted duration of the request level. The system may receive status information from fleet vehicles and identify a vehicle in need of service. The system may receive status information from service centers and identify a service center to service the vehicle. The system may determine a time at which to service the vehicle at the identified service center based on the generated prediction of requests, schedule the vehicle for service at the identified service center at the determined time, and instruct the vehicle to drive to the service center to be serviced at the determined time. In particular embodiments, the prediction of requests may be generated using machine learning.

  • Patent number: 10147453
    Abstract: This disclosure is related to systems, devices, processes, and methods to optimize a laser power boost amplitude, a laser power boost duration, or both in a heat-assisted data recording device, such as in heat-assisted magnetic recording (HAMR). The amplitude and duration for the laser power boost may be determined for a specific portion of a write operation, such as a first sector of the write operation. During operation of a data storage device, the laser power boost may provide additional power to the laser for the specific portion. Once the laser power boost duration has elapsed, the data storage device may continue providing power to the laser at the normal power input range of the laser. The laser power boost settings may be determined on a per head per zone basis, per track basis, or another configuration.

  • Publication number: 20180319394
    Abstract: Disclosed is a fail-safe system for vehicle proximity including, in some embodiments, an autonomous-vehicle control system onboard a vehicle, a brake system of the vehicle, and at least one onboard transceiver onboard the vehicle. An autonomous-vehicle control-system module can be configured with collision-determining logic. A brake-system module can be configured to slow down or stop the vehicle upon receiving a braking-process instruction from the control-system module. A transceiver module can be configured to receive signals from at least one external transmitter moving toward or away from the vehicle. The transceiver module can be configured to send to the control-system module proximity information for the external transmitter as it moves toward or away from the vehicle.
